Transaction 69a8f720741e01f739e475f7bf0b40be9dc1dd7200e1808b08604363d0a8b30d

block
d2d7f1f6010600db7553fe959af17c04b3ea4dd4614d45416074014becc515f3

11 Inputs

2001 Outputs